The story of the community is one of a transformation from a grassroots open-source project to a core component of a global enterprise data platform. Originally known as Kettle , PDI has evolved into a versatile tool for Extract, Transform, and Load (ETL) processes, maintained by a dedicated group of developers and users. Pentaho Data Integration is a graphical tool that allows users to create complex data manipulations without writing a single line of code. It uses a "metadata-driven" approach, meaning you define what you want to happen through a drag-and-drop interface, and the engine handles the execution.
